Biodegradable Ice Bags

Biodegradable ice bags are environmentally friendly packaging bags specially designed for storing, transporting, and selling ice cubes or crushed ice. Unlike traditional plastic ice bags made from conventional polyethylene (PE), biodegradable ice bags are produced using biodegradable or bio-based materials that can gradually break down under appropriate environmental conditions, helping reduce long-term plastic waste and environmental impact.

Designed to withstand freezing temperatures and moisture, biodegradable ice bags offer excellent strength, puncture resistance, and leak-proof performance while maintaining the freshness and cleanliness of packaged ice. Biodegradable Ice Bags: Context And History

For decades, disposable plastic ice bags have been widely used in supermarkets, convenience stores, gas stations, restaurants, hotels, food processing facilities, and ice manufacturing plants. Their low cost and excellent moisture resistance made polyethylene (PE) the preferred material for packaging ice.

However, traditional plastic ice bags present significant environmental challenges. Because conventional plastics degrade extremely slowly, billions of discarded ice bags accumulate in landfills and natural environments every year.

Growing environmental awareness, stricter plastic reduction policies, and increasing consumer demand for sustainable packaging have encouraged manufacturers to develop biodegradable alternatives. Advances in biodegradable polymer technology now allow ice bags to deliver similar durability, sealing performance, and moisture resistance while reducing long-term environmental impact.

Today, biodegradable ice bags are becoming an important packaging solution for businesses seeking environmentally responsible products without compromising packaging quality.

Biodegradable Vs Compostable Ice Bags

Although these two terms are often used interchangeably, they describe different environmental characteristics.

Biodegradable ice bags are designed to break down naturally over time through the action of microorganisms. The degradation rate depends on environmental factors such as temperature, humidity, oxygen, and microbial activity.

Compostable ice bags are manufactured to decompose completely under controlled composting conditions within a specified time period, leaving no toxic residues. Certified compostable bags typically comply with standards such as ASTM D6400 or EN 13432.

The major differences include:

Feature Biodegradable Ice Bags Compostable Ice Bags
Breakdown process Natural biological degradation Controlled composting
Decomposition speed Varies by environment Faster under composting conditions
Certification May or may not require certification Usually certified
End products Biomass, water, CO₂ Biomass, water, CO₂ without harmful residue
Disposal Landfill or industrial composting depending on material Industrial composting preferred

Understanding these differences helps buyers select the most appropriate packaging for their sustainability goals.

Common Materials Used In Biodegradable Ice Bags

Several biodegradable materials are commonly used in manufacturing.

PLA (Polylactic Acid)

Derived from renewable resources such as corn starch or sugarcane, PLA offers excellent transparency and is widely used in sustainable packaging.

PBAT (Polybutylene Adipate Terephthalate)

PBAT provides flexibility, toughness, and excellent elongation, making it suitable for frozen packaging applications.

Corn Starch Blends

Modified starch materials improve biodegradability while helping reduce reliance on petroleum-based plastics.

Bio-Based Polymers

These renewable materials partially or fully replace fossil-based plastics and contribute to lowering carbon emissions.

Compostable Polymer Blends

Many premium biodegradable ice bags use specially engineered compostable resin blends to meet international environmental standards.

How To Use Biodegradable Ice Bags Effectively

Proper handling helps maximize product performance.

Recommended practices include:

  • Fill bags with clean food-grade ice.
  • Avoid overfilling to prevent excessive pressure.
  • Seal bags securely using heat sealing or tie closures if required.
  • Store filled bags immediately in freezer conditions.
  • Avoid exposure to sharp objects during transportation.
  • Stack cartons properly to prevent punctures.
  • Rotate inventory using the first-in, first-out (FIFO) method.

Following these guidelines improves packaging efficiency and reduces product damage.

How To Dispose Of Biodegradable Ice Bags

Correct disposal depends on the material used.

Recommended options include:

  • Follow local waste disposal regulations.
  • Separate biodegradable packaging from recyclable plastics if required.
  • Industrial composting when applicable.
  • Dispose of food residues before discarding the bag.
  • Do not litter in natural environments.

Some biodegradable materials require specific composting conditions to achieve optimal decomposition, so always verify disposal recommendations with the manufacturer.

Are biodegradable ice bags really biodegradable?

Yes. They are manufactured using biodegradable materials that can break down through natural biological processes under appropriate environmental conditions. The actual degradation time depends on the material formulation and disposal environment.

What is the difference between biodegradable and compostable ice bags?

Biodegradable bags naturally decompose over time, while compostable bags are designed to completely break down under controlled composting conditions and usually meet recognized compostability standards.

Are biodegradable ice bags safe for food contact?

High-quality biodegradable ice bags can be produced using food-grade materials that comply with applicable food-contact regulations. Always confirm certifications with the manufacturer before use.

Can biodegradable ice bags be recycled?

Most biodegradable materials should not be mixed with conventional plastic recycling streams. Follow local waste management guidelines or the manufacturer’s disposal recommendations.

How long do biodegradable ice bags take to decompose?

Decomposition time varies depending on the material type, temperature, humidity, oxygen availability, and microbial activity. Under suitable conditions, biodegradable materials generally break down much faster than conventional plastics.
